Questions and Answers Date answered: 18 March 2024

S6W-25621

Scottish Government officials participate in a Devolved Administrations Working Group established by the UK Government which meets regularly to discuss issues relating to the development of legislation to quash the wrongful convictions of sub-postmasters and sub-postmistresses. This will assist in the development of equivalent legislation that will apply to sub-postmasters and post office employees convicted by courts in Scotland if the UK Government does not change its position on legislating only to reverse the convictions of those convicted in courts in England and Wales.

Official Report Meeting date: 10 February 2026

Equalities, Human Rights and Civil Justice Committee 10 February 2026 [Draft]

On the business benefits front, we did a big report back in 2024 called “Neuroinclusion at work”, which was based on an employer survey and an employee survey. That report showed very clearly that employers who invest additional resources and put more effort into neuro-inclusion later report not only positive organisational outcomes but also positive individual outcomes around employee wellbeing and employee performance.
